The Titles for Episodes 1123 and 1124 Are Revealed

The One Piece anime went on a hiatus about 6 months ago. Fans have been waiting very patiently, and luckily, the wait is almost over as the One Piece anime prepares to return from this long break. The One Piece anime is set to make its comeback on April 5.

By now, some fans might have heard the big news. The One Piece anime is returning with two episodes back to back. These two episodes are One Piece 1123 and One Piece 1124, and they will be released one day apart from each other. One Piece Episode 1123 will drop on April 5, and One Piece Episode 1124 on April 6. This is definitely major as it is almost unheard of for One Piece.

While fans wait for One Piece episode 1123 to drop in about a week, the titles of the upcoming One Piece episodes, 1123 and 1124, have now been revealed.

One Piece 1123 is titled “The World is in Shock: The Straw Hat Barricade Incident”. Meanwhile, One Piece 1124 is titled “Fully Surrounded! The Escape Strategy”.

Along with that, it has also been revealed that the anime will return with a new opening and ending. The anime is only a bit over a week away now, and fans absolutely cannot wait to catch a glimpse of Luffy and the Straw Hat Pirates as they face off against the massive fleet of the Navy that encircles Egghead, and at the same time, the threat of an Admiral and an Elder.
